Elon MuskYeah. I've been asked for many years about taking SpaceX public. So, it's probably been I don't know almost 10 years that people have been suggesting to me that I should take SpaceX public. We've been positive cash flow for quite a long time. I think since around 2014 2015 and we've been self-funding in fact in our private equity rounds they actually have not been fundraising rounds. They've been liquidity rounds for investors and and employees because we give everyone at the company stock and SpaceX has actually bought back stock in most of our sort of funding events.是的。多年来一直有人问我把 SpaceX 上市的事,我估计快接近10年了吧,一直有人建议我这么做。我们很早就实现了正向现金流,我想大概是2014、2015年前后开始的,一直是自给自足的状态。事实上,我们过去的私募轮融资并不真正是融资轮,而是流动性轮——为投资者和员工提供变现机会,因为公司给所有人都发股票,而 SpaceX 在大多数所谓"融资"活动中实际上是在回购股票。

3:27

Elon MuskSo what's different about now is that it's a number of things but we are embarking on a significant growth phase like a capital growth phase where we're we are going to put in orbit probably a 100,000 satellites but probably over 100,000 satellites just for communications and these will be of the version three and beyond versus version two and version one that are currently in orbit. Version three is, depending on how you count it, 10 to 20 times more capable than the version two satellite. And there were three chips that the SpaceX chip design team taped out that are specific to this that are far beyond state-of-the-art, which means it's it's 100 times more bandwidth than the SpaceX Starlink system currently offers and also half the latency because the altitude will be about half altitude. I think it will actually be the highest bandwidth, lowest latency means of communicating.那现在为什么不一样了?有几个原因,最重要的一点是我们正在进入一个重大增长阶段——资本密集型的增长阶段。我们计划向轨道发射大概10万颗卫星,甚至可能超过10万颗,仅用于通信,这些都是第三代及更新版本,而非目前在轨的第一代和第二代。V3 卫星的能力,取决于怎么算,是 V2 的10到20倍。SpaceX 芯片设计团队为此流片了三款专用芯片,远超当前业界最先进水平——这意味着带宽是 SpaceX Starlink 现有系统的100倍,同时延迟降低一半,因为轨道高度大约只有原来的一半。我认为它将真正成为带宽最高、延迟最低的通信手段。

Jamie DimonSo Starship, you built it. Unbelievable ship. I think it's already had 12 flights I read. But obviously technical technically it's just hard to do. What were some of the breakthroughs you had that people should know about that they don't know about?说到 Starship,你建成了它,令人叹为观止。我看资料说已经飞了12次了。但从技术上讲,这确实极其困难。有哪些突破是人们应该了解、但其实不太知道的?

10:33

Elon MuskWe we our webcasts are very good. So I recommend anyone who wants if they want to learn about Starship the SpaceX website or the any of the Starship live casts are great way to learn about it. But the really the fundamental breakthrough of Starship is that it will be the first orbital rocket that is fully reusable. So this might sound like an obvious thing, but because in every other mode of transport, whether that's aircraft, vehic, you know, cars, bicycles, horses, you name it, ships, these are all we take it for granted that there are reusable. An aircraft journey would be very expensive if you had to throw the plane away every time. And that's how rockets have been in the past. But it's very difficult from a technology standpoint to achieve full reusability for a rocket. We've got part of the way there with Falcon 9, but we'll get all the way there with Starship.我们的直播做得非常好,所以我建议任何想了解 Starship 的人去看 SpaceX 官网或者任何一次 Starship 直播,都是很好的入门方式。但 Starship 真正的根本性突破,在于它将是第一枚完全可重复使用的入轨火箭。这听起来好像显而易见,但仔细想想:所有其他交通方式——飞机、汽车、自行车、马、船——我们都理所当然地认为它们可以重复使用。如果每次坐飞机都要把飞机扔掉,票价会贵得离谱。过去火箭就是这样。但要让火箭实现完全可重复使用,在技术上极其困难。我们在 Falcon 9 上走了一半的路,Starship 会走完全程。

11:21

Elon MuskAnd once you achieve full reusability, then it's simply a cost. It's simply the the cost of access to to orbit is just the cost of propellant because now you can reuse all aspects of the vehicle. And the propellant we used for Starship is liquid oxygen and liquid liquid methane, which is the cheapest propellant you could possibly get. We can just literally get oxygen from the air and methane from natural gas. So the cost of propellant for Starship will be less than the cost of jet aviation fuel, which means that you should be able to actually send cargo to space for less than the cost of cargo on an airplane going on a trans oceanic trip.一旦实现完全可重复使用,进入轨道的成本就只剩推进剂的成本——因为运载工具所有部件都可以重复使用。Starship 用的推进剂是液氧和液态甲烷,这是你能找到的最便宜的推进剂,字面意义上就是从空气里取氧气,从天然气里取甲烷。所以 Starship 的推进剂成本将低于航空燃油的成本——这意味着把货物送上太空,实际上可以比跨洋航班的货运费用还要便宜。

Jamie DimonReally cool. Starlink. Another thing that has been amazing, global communications. We already mentioned Ukraine. You had mentioned to me that V3 would maybe be able to replace some of these cyber cables, which by the way is a huge security risk for all of us because several have already been cut in the Baltic Sea. So, what's the next view for Starlink, both V3 and maybe V4?真的很酷。Starlink,另一个令人惊叹的成就,全球通信。我们前面也提到了乌克兰。你跟我说过 V3 可能替代一部分海底光缆,顺便说一句,这对我们所有人都是巨大的安全隐患,因为波罗的海已经有好几根被切断了。Starlink 下一步的规划是什么?V3 和 V4 分别有什么计划?

12:29

Elon MuskYeah. So, the V3 satellite is a a gig and you can look it up on the internet. As I said, it's 10 to 20 times more capable than V2. It's a very big satellite. In fact, it can only be launched on Starship. It's so it's too big to be launched on any other rocket on Earth. So, Starship has a 30ft diameter cargo bay. And the the V3 satellites are, let's see, they're about 7 m, so about 20 22 23 feet wide. So, very big, like the size of a small bus essentially. And they there's a bunch of technical details about we have much bigger phased array antennas. We've got we've got more ground links. We've got more of our laser. Our satellites communicate with each other with lasers that we developed and manufacture. So, it's got a lot more lasers and more advanced lasers. It's also got Wband and Eband. These are technical details, but it's it's got a lot of it's trans it's it's like a crazy orbiting radio station.是的。V3 卫星,你可以去网上查,就像我说的,是 V2 能力的10到20倍。它是一颗非常大的卫星,事实上只能用 Starship 来发射,因为它对任何其他地球上的火箭来说都太大了。Starship 有一个直径30英尺的货舱,而 V3 卫星大约7米宽,也就是大概22到23英尺,基本上是一辆小型公共汽车的大小。技术细节上,我们有更大的相控阵天线,更多的地面链路,更多的激光——我们的卫星之间通过我们自研自产的激光互相通信。V3 有更多、更先进的激光,还配备了 W 波段和 E 波段。这些是技术细节,但总之它就像一座疯狂的轨道无线电站。

13:29

Jamie DimonAnd doesn't doesn't Starship do 12 of them or 15 at once?Starship 不是一次能发12颗或15颗吗?

13:35

Elon MuskIt should be able to do 50.应该能发50颗。

13:37

Jamie Dimon50.50颗。

13:38

Elon MuskYeah. Because Starship is Starship V3 is aimed at aiming to do 100 tons to orbit with full reusability. And then Starship V4, we're aiming for over 200 tons per mission and then being able to launch every hour.是的。因为 Starship V3 的目标是完全可重复使用的情况下将100吨载荷送入轨道。然后 Starship V4 我们的目标是每次任务超过200吨,同时能够每小时发射一次。

Jamie DimonNext one. Data centers in space. You've been talking about that. Other people have mentioned it, but obviously it has different technical capabilities. It's colder up there. It's less vibration, but you also got to get the data back to the Earth by some method. I think you mentioned be lasers in good weather and bad. And so, how hard is it to do now that you've looked at it for a while?下一个问题。太空数据中心,你一直在谈这个,别人也提到过,它显然有不同的技术优势——上面更冷、振动更小——但数据还是得通过某种方式传回地球。我记得你提到无论天气好坏都可以用激光。那你研究了一段时间之后,觉得这件事有多难做?

14:16

Elon MuskWe don't think this is a particularly difficult thing to do. In fact, we think it's easier than our communication satellites. Quite a bit easier than our communication satellites. The Starlink V3 communication satellites is an incredibly complex machine. The AI data center would be much simpler by comparison because it's really just solar power plus radiator, some basic equipment for operating the satellite and and then the laser links which would connect to the Starlink communication constellation and then back and then to the ground. And it would the connection would happen no matter what the weather is because once you connect via lasers to the Starlink communication constellation the Starlink communicates to the ground with frequencies that are cloud penetrating. So they in fact even roof penetrating to some degree. So you you would always be able to close link with the the data centers.我们认为这并不是特别困难的事,事实上,我们觉得它比我们的通信卫星要简单得多。Starlink V3 通信卫星是一台极其复杂的机器,而 AI 数据中心相比之下要简单多了,因为它本质上就是太阳能加散热器,加上一些基本的卫星操控设备,再加上激光链路——连接到 Starlink 通信星座,再传回地面。而且无论什么天气,连接都不会中断,因为一旦通过激光连接到 Starlink 通信星座,Starlink 再与地面的通信使用的是能穿透云层的频率,甚至在一定程度上能穿透屋顶。所以你永远都能和数据中心保持链路。

Jamie DimonExcellent. Talking about America. One of the big things here, we've been talking about the reindustrialization of America for a long time, bringing back advanced manufacturing, and now you're talking about building the terra fab, building chip fabs in New York. What what compelled you to do that now with all the other things you're working on?很好。说到美国,我们谈了很长时间美国再工业化的问题,把先进制造业带回来。现在你还在谈在纽约建 terra fab、建芯片工厂。在你做了这么多事情的情况下,是什么促使你现在决定做这件事?

15:24

Elon MuskWe try to So, what's the limiting factor? And the limiting factor, what we see as limiting factor is being able to make chips, both logic, memory, and packaging. It's worth noting that there's not a single high volume computer memory fab in America right now. Zero. There's one being built in Idaho by Micron, but that will not reach volume production till I believe 2028. And there's something built in New York, but they are in I think 29 and 30. And this is a tiny fraction of the memory that's needed. And in fact even if you take the best case assumptions of the the memory makers and the logic makers it is not enough to meet the demand that is anticipated which is why you're seeing stocks of micron go to I think 1.2 trillion or some quite high number. The so there's just clearly a need for AI logic, memory and packaging, AI computers essentially that is far beyond what even the best case assumptions of the existing fabricators can do and that's why we need to do the terra fab.我们会去想:限制因素是什么?在我们看来,限制因素在于能否制造芯片——逻辑芯片、内存芯片和封装。值得注意的是,美国目前没有一家大规模量产的计算机内存芯片工厂,一家都没有。Micron 正在爱达荷州建一家,但预计到2028年才能达到量产规模;纽约也有在建的,但我想是2029年和2030年。而且这些产能加在一起也只是所需内存的一小部分。事实上,就算把内存厂商和逻辑芯片厂商最乐观的假设全部加起来,仍然无法满足预期需求——这就是为什么你看到 Micron 的股票涨到我记得好像是1.2万亿美元,或者某个相当高的数字。所以,AI 对逻辑芯片、内存和封装——也就是 AI 计算机——的需求,显然远远超过了现有晶圆厂最乐观估计的产能,这就是我们必须建 terra fab 的原因。
